CD300E FISH Probe

The CD300E FISH probe is designed to hybridize to the CD300E gene and is primarily used for detecting amplifications and deletions associated with the gene. This probe is FISH confirmed on normal peripheral blood metaphase spreads and interphase nuclei. The probe can be labeled in one of five colors. Gene Summary

This gene encodes a member of the CD300 glycoprotein family of cell surface proteins expressed on myeloid cells. The protein interacts with the TYRO protein tyrosine kinase-binding protein and is thought to act as an activating receptor. [provided by RefSeq, Nov 2012]

Gene Details

Gene Symbol: CD300E

Gene Name: CD300e Molecule

Chromosome: CHR17: 72606021-72619897

Locus: 17q25.1
